Route.phpnamespace sys; class Route { static public function getNamespaceOfRunFile() { // 这里的 namespace 关键字将返回 'sys' echo __NAMESPACE__; } }app/example.php 立即学习“PHP免费学习笔记(深入)”;namespace app\example; use sys\Route; Route::getNamespaceOfRunFile(); // 期望输出 "app\example",但实际输出 "sys"很明显,__NAMESPACE__魔术常量总是指向当前文件声明的命名空间。
但这与本文讨论的直接视图渲染或内部方法调用场景不同。
在构建 Golang Web 服务时,API 接口的响应格式统一是提升前后端协作效率、增强可维护性的关键实践。
我通常会从以下几个方面考虑: 明确职责分离:首先,清晰地定义你的目标结构体(例如 HttpClientConfig),它应该只关注数据和行为,不掺杂构建逻辑。
主题兼容性: 如果您使用的是第三方主题,并且该主题有自己的更新机制,请优先考虑通过主题更新来解决此问题,而不是手动修改。
立即学习“C++免费学习笔记(深入)”; 示例: struct MyFunctor { void operator()(int value) const { cout << "Functor 回调: " << value << endl; } }; // 使用方式 doWork(MyFunctor{}); 4. 成员函数作为回调 成员函数有隐含的 this 指针,不能直接用函数指针传递。
在PHP代码中,你可以通过 $_GET['url'] 获取重写后的URL路径,也可以继续使用 $_SERVER['REQUEST_URI'],但需要注意其包含前导斜杠。
盘古大模型 华为云推出的一系列高性能人工智能大模型 35 查看详情 核心概念与使用 在SQLModel中,你的模型既是SQLAlchemy的表定义,又是Pydantic的数据模式。
错误恢复(Recovery):捕获处理函数中可能发生的panic,并将其转换为HTTP 500错误响应,避免服务崩溃。
对于20,000行数据,如果需要处理数千个不同的app_id,将导致数千次数据库查询,性能将急剧下降。
核心挑战:无内置机制回传环境变更 Go的os/exec包旨在提供一个简洁的接口来执行外部命令并捕获其标准输出、错误输出以及退出状态码。
我们可以利用这个特性,模拟 Node.js 的 Buffer 行为。
find_first_of():查找任意一个匹配字符的首次出现(如查找标点)。
校验过程应收集所有错误信息,而非遇到第一个错误就中断,以便一次性反馈给用户。
与pathlib结合: 对于更现代的Python文件系统操作,可以考虑结合 pathlib 模块。
权限和性能:批量处理时注意内存限制,处理完记得调用 imagedestroy() 释放资源。
• 在“SQL Server网络配置”中,确认“TCP/IP”协议已启用。
准确掌握内存占用对优化程序、减少GC压力至关重要。
XML解析错误通常由格式不正确或结构问题引起,处理的关键是定位错误源头并修复语法。
解决方案核心:启用HTTPS 解决此问题的最直接且推荐的方法是为您的应用程序启用HTTPS。
本文链接:http://www.andazg.com/233222_291744.html